Parent Log:
http://ci.aztec-labs.com/5c36f3dacbf18e42
Command: 49f5129a0dc39cfa yarn-project/scripts/run_test.sh pxe/src/storage/capsule_data_provider/capsule_data_provider.test.ts
Commit:
https://github.com/AztecProtocol/aztec-packages/commit/4c695be4bff40a4a2ca2118c7e14c83a104e93aa
Env: REF_NAME=gh-readonly-queue/next/pr-15120-bbf33e6534f745d2f5a11c2f359583e881120fc4 CURRENT_VERSION=0.87.6 CI_FULL=1
Date: Wed Jun 18 17:22:52 UTC 2025
System: ARCH=amd64 CPUS=128 MEM=493Gi HOSTNAME=pr-15120_amd64_x2-full
Resources: CPU_LIST=0-127 CPUS=2 MEM=8g TIMEOUT=600s
History:
http://ci.aztec-labs.com/list/history_cf49130407db039d_next
17:22:54 [17:22:54.805]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:54 [17:22:54.854]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:54 [17:22:54.884]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:54 [17:22:54.914]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:54 [17:22:54.949]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:54 [17:22:54.967]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:55 [17:22:55.000]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:55 [17:22:55.020]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:55 [17:22:55.058]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:55 [17:22:55.104]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:55 [17:22:55.153]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:55 [17:22:55.209]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:55 [17:22:55.252]
ERROR:
kv-store:lmdb-v2:capsule_data_provider_test Failed to commit transaction: Error: Attempted to copy empty slot 0x13ddb42e1d1398927205975703356477c0a5f96e2b4f423d7a1e50b0b50d18c9:0x0000000000000000000000000000000000000000000000000000000000000002 for contract 0x13ddb42e1d1398927205975703356477c0a5f96e2b4f423d7a1e50b0b50d18c9
17:22:55 at /home/aztec-dev/aztec-packages/yarn-project/pxe/src/storage/capsule_data_provider/capsule_data_provider.ts:64:17
17:22:55 at /home/aztec-dev/aztec-packages/yarn-project/kv-store/dest/lmdb-v2/store.js:111:29
17:22:55 at /home/aztec-dev/aztec-packages/yarn-project/foundation/dest/queue/serial_queue.js:58:33
17:22:55 at FifoMemoryQueue.process (/home/aztec-dev/aztec-packages/yarn-project/foundation/dest/queue/base_memory_queue.js:110:17)
17:22:55 [17:22:55.257]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:55 [17:22:55.285]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:55 [17:22:55.322]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:55 [17:22:55.339]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:55 [17:22:55.372]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:55 [17:22:55.395]
ERROR:
kv-store:lmdb-v2:capsule_data_provider_test Failed to commit transaction: Error: Expected non-empty value at capsule array in base slot 0x0000000000000000000000000000000000000000000000000000000000000003 at index 0 for contract 0x28595a9e22390a391899404ac38acb2fcfe69d06f503c3a77c41d9f5f6803750
17:22:55 at /home/aztec-dev/aztec-packages/yarn-project/pxe/src/storage/capsule_data_provider/capsule_data_provider.ts:110:17
17:22:55 at /home/aztec-dev/aztec-packages/yarn-project/kv-store/dest/lmdb-v2/store.js:111:29
17:22:55 at /home/aztec-dev/aztec-packages/yarn-project/foundation/dest/queue/serial_queue.js:58:33
17:22:55 at FifoMemoryQueue.process (/home/aztec-dev/aztec-packages/yarn-project/foundation/dest/queue/base_memory_queue.js:110:17)
17:22:55 [17:22:55.399]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:55 [17:22:55.425]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:55 [17:22:55.474]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:55 [17:22:55.523]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:55 [17:22:55.575]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:56 [17:22:56.999]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:57 [17:22:57.937]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:22:59 [17:22:59.120]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:23:02 [17:23:02.061]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:23:04 [17:23:04.739]
INFO:
kv-store:lmdb-v2:capsule_data_provider_test Starting data store with maxReaders 16
17:23:06
PASS src/storage/capsule_data_provider/capsule_data_provider.test.ts (
12.206 s)
17:23:06 capsule data provider
17:23:06 store and load
17:23:06
✓ stores and loads a single value (273 ms)
17:23:06
✓ stores and loads multiple values (28 ms)
17:23:06
✓ overwrites existing values (30 ms)
17:23:06
✓ stores values for different contracts independently (34 ms)
17:23:06
✓ returns null for non-existent slots (18 ms)
17:23:06 delete
17:23:06
✓ deletes a slot (31 ms)
17:23:06
✓ deletes an empty slot (20 ms)
17:23:06 copy
17:23:06
✓ copies a single value (37 ms)
17:23:06
✓ copies multiple non-overlapping values (46 ms)
17:23:06
✓ copies overlapping values with src ahead (46 ms)
17:23:06
✓ copies overlapping values with dst ahead (53 ms)
17:23:06
✓ copying fails if any value is empty (49 ms)
17:23:06 arrays
17:23:06 appendToCapsuleArray
17:23:06
✓ creates a new array (27 ms)
17:23:06
✓ appends to an existing array (36 ms)
17:23:06 readCapsuleArray
17:23:06
✓ reads an empty array (17 ms)
17:23:06
✓ reads an existing array (32 ms)
17:23:06
✓ throws on a corrupted array (27 ms)
17:23:06 resetCapsuleArray
17:23:06
✓ resets an empty array (26 ms)
17:23:06
✓ resets an existing shorter array (47 ms)
17:23:06
✓ resets an existing longer array (48 ms)
17:23:06
✓ clears an existing array (50 ms)
17:23:06 performance tests
17:23:06
✓ create large array by appending (1426 ms)
17:23:06
✓ create large array by resetting (936 ms)
17:23:06
✓ append to large array (1184 ms)
17:23:06
✓ copy large number of elements (2938 ms)
17:23:06
✓ read a large array (2678 ms)
17:23:06
✓ clear a large array (1451 ms)
17:23:06
17:23:06
Test Suites: 1 passed, 1 total
17:23:06
Tests: 27 passed, 27 total
17:23:06
Snapshots: 0 total
17:23:06
Time: 12.297 s
17:23:06
Ran all test suites matching pxe/src/storage/capsule_data_provider/capsule_data_provider.test.ts
.
17:23:06
Force exiting Jest: Have you considered using `--detectOpenHandles` to detect async operations that kept running after all tests finished?